Dental alloys are metal mixtures specially designed for use in various dental applications, including crowns, bridges, implants, and removable prostheses. Dental alloys are polycrystalline solids consisting of many individual grains (crystals) separated by grain boundaries. Heterogeneous nucleation —formation of solid.
